Description
This function resets all of the dynamicui.conf
file's items.
Note:
cPanel API 2's Branding
module only modifies data for the x3 theme.
Warning:
We strongly recommend that you use UAPI instead of cPanel API 2. However, no equivalent UAPI function exists.
Examples
https://hostname.example.com:2087/cpsess###########/json-api/cpanel?cpanel_jsonapi_user=user&cpanel_jsonapi_apiversion=2&cpanel_jsonapi_module=Branding&cpanel_jsonapi_func=resetall
$cpanel
=
new
CPANEL();
// Connect to cPanel - only do this once.
// Reset branding items.
$reset_items
=
$cpanel
->api2(
'Branding'
,
'resetall'
);
my
$cpliveapi
= Cpanel::LiveAPI->new();
# Connect to cPanel - only do this once.
# Reset branding items.
my
$reset_items
=
$cpliveapi
->api2(
'Branding'
,
'resetall'
,
);
Warning:
In cPanel & WHM version 11.30 and later, cPanel tags are deprecated. We strongly recommend that you only use the LiveAPI system to call the cPanel APIs.
cPanel API 2 calls that use cPanel tags vary widely in code syntax and in their output. For more information, read our Deprecated cPanel Tag Usage documentation. Examples are only present in order to help developers move from the old cPanel tag system to our LiveAPI.
cpapi2 --user=username Branding resetall |
Notes:
- You must URI-encode values.
- username represents your account-level username.
{
"cpanelresult": {
"apiversion": 2,
"func": "resetall",
"data": [
{
"file": "addondomain"
},
{
"file": "analogstats"
},
{
"file": "anonymousmsg"
},
{
"file": "apache"
},
{
"file": "awstats"
},
{
"file": "backup-wizard"
},
{
"file": "boxtrapper"
},
{
"file": "branding"
},
{
"file": "cgi-center"
},
{
"file": "changelang"
},
{
"file": "chooselog"
},
{
"file": "clam"
},
{
"file": "cpanelAPI"
},
{
"file": "cron"
},
{
"file": "csvimport"
},
{
"file": "defaultemailacct"
},
{
"file": "dfiltering"
},
{
"file": "email-reports"
},
{
"file": "emailarch"
},
{
"file": "emailauth"
},
{
"file": "emailmx"
},
{
"file": "enduserlve"
},
{
"file": "errorlogs"
},
{
"file": "errorpage"
},
{
"file": "favorites"
},
{
"file": "filemanager"
},
{
"file": "forwardersemail"
},
{
"file": "ftpaccounts"
},
{
"file": "ftpcontrol"
},
{
"file": "getstart"
},
{
"file": "group_advanced"
},
{
"file": "group_db"
},
{
"file": "group_domains"
},
{
"file": "group_files"
},
{
"file": "group_logs"
},
{
"file": "group_mail"
},
{
"file": "group_pref"
},
{
"file": "group_sec"
},
{
"file": "group_software"
},
{
"file": "hd"
},
{
"file": "hdspace"
},
{
"file": "hotlinkprotect"
},
{
"file": "image-manager"
},
{
"file": "index"
},
{
"file": "ipdeny"
},
{
"file": "keys"
},
{
"file": "latestvisitors"
},
{
"file": "leechprotect"
},
{
"file": "legacy_filemanager"
},
{
"file": "lookandfeel"
},
{
"file": "maillist"
},
{
"file": "manageaccounts"
},
{
"file": "mime-types"
},
{
"file": "mod_security"
},
{
"file": "mysql"
},
{
"file": "mysql-remoteaccess"
},
{
"file": "mysql-wizard3"
},
{
"file": "nettools"
},
{
"file": "networkmonitor"
},
{
"file": "optimizews"
},
{
"file": "parkeddomains"
},
{
"file": "password"
},
{
"file": "password-protect"
},
{
"file": "perl"
},
{
"file": "php"
},
{
"file": "php-pear"
},
{
"file": "phpMyAdmin"
},
{
"file": "phpPgAdmin"
},
{
"file": "postgresql"
},
{
"file": "postgresql-wizard"
},
{
"file": "rails"
},
{
"file": "rawaccesslogs"
},
{
"file": "redirects"
},
{
"file": "responder"
},
{
"file": "ruby"
},
{
"file": "scripts-library"
},
{
"file": "sec_policy"
},
{
"file": "simplezoneedit"
},
{
"file": "spamassassin"
},
{
"file": "ssh-shell-access"
},
{
"file": "ssl-manager"
},
{
"file": "subdomains"
},
{
"file": "submit-support"
},
{
"file": "tutorials"
},
{
"file": "updatecontact"
},
{
"file": "urchin"
},
{
"file": "userfiltering"
},
{
"file": "webalizerftp"
},
{
"file": "webalizerlog"
},
{
"file": "webdav"
},
{
"file": "webemail"
},
{
"file": "whm"
},
{
"file": "zoneedit"
}
],
"event": {
"result": 1
},
"module": "Branding"
}
}
Note:
Use cPanel's API Shell interface (Home >> Advanced >> API Shell) to directly test cPanel API calls.
Parameters
This function does not accept parameters.
Returns
Return |
Type |
Description |
Possible values |
Example |
file |
string |
The updated branding item. |
The name of a dynamicui.conf item. |
addondomain |
result |
Boolean |
Whether the function succeeded. |
|
1 |